Vietnam Airlines has just officially received a new Airbus A320neo aircraft with registration number VN-A514.
The new Airbus A320neo is equipped with a new generation of engines, bringing outstanding improvements in efficiency and environmental protection. Accordingly, this aircraft line helps save more than 16% of fuel consumption, reduce noise by up to 75% and cut about 50% of toxic emissions compared to previous engine lines. The A320neo aircraft are expected to be operated on domestic routes.The Airbus A320neo saves more than 16% on fuel consumption, reduces noise by up to 75% and cuts harmful emissions by around 50%.
The addition of new aircraft has brought the airline's total aircraft fleet to 103 this year, including 31 wide-body aircraft such as the Boeing 787-9, Boeing 787-10 and Airbus A350. Previously, in early December 2024, Vietnam Airlines received 1 A320neo with registration number VN-A515 and 1 Boeing 787-10 with registration number VN-A877 to serve the Tet peak.Inside the passenger cabin of the A320neo.
